Summary

Dr. Peter Marks is a thoracic surgeon with five decades of experience in specialized chest and lung procedures. He earned his medical degree from Louisiana State University School of Medicine in New Orleans and completed his residency training at University of Illinois Hospital. Dr. Marks brings extensive expertise to complex surgical cases and communicates with patients in English.

Dr. Marks practices at Beloit Memorial Hospital and serves patients in both Beloit, Wisconsin and Rockford, Illinois. His thoracic surgery expertise focuses on treating conditions affecting the chest, lungs, and surrounding structures. Patients consistently rate Dr. Marks highly for his surgical care, giving him an average rating of 4.9 out of 5 stars.
